Hallo zusammen,
für meine eigene Webstatistik experimentiere ich zum ersten Mal mit "Geplante Aufgaben" in PLESK. Ich habe zum Test ein Miniskript geschrieben:
<?
$now = date ("Y-m-d H:i:s");
$log = fopen ("logs/log.txt", "a");
fwrite ($log, "CRONSTATS: $now\r\n");
fclose ($log);
?>
Wenn ich dieses ganz normal im Browser aufrufe, tut es einfach, was es soll (in die Logdatei schreiben).
Dann habe ich dieses Skript in PLESK unter "Geplante Aufgaben" als Aufgabentyp "PHP-Skript ausführen" eingehängt (siehe Bild). Probiere ich es mit "Jetzt ausführen" aus, so bekomme ich eine Rückmeldung "Die Aufgabe "httpdocs/crontest.php" wurde erfolgreich in 0 Sekunden abgeschlossen." Aber: in meiner Logdatei erfolgt kein Eintrag. Ebensowenig, wenn die Geplante Aufgabe zeitgesteuert ausgeführt wird.
Dasselbe gilt für ein weiteres Testskript, indem ich etwas in meine Datenbank schreibe: Beim Browseraufruf tut das Skript, was es soll, beim Aufruf über Plesk nicht.
Verstehe ich da jetzt irgendwas falsch?
Danke für eure Unterstützung.
Diethard